How To Fix FARR_RAI770 - Comp.code &1/acct.pr. &2: invalid transfer date (productive is greater)


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: FARR_RAI - Revenue Accounting Item

  • Message number: 770

  • Message text: Comp.code &1/acct.pr. &2: invalid transfer date (productive is greater)

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    Transfer date of the company code &v1& and accounting principle &v2& is
    neither equal nor greater then the transfer dates defined in the
    existing productive accounting principles of the company code.

    System Response

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.
